Injuries, charges after drunk driving incident

At 10:05 PM police responded to 267 Prince Albert Road in Dartmouth.
Multiple witnesses reported hearing a loud crash and some seeing a pick up truck drive recklessly before leaving the road and striking a pole.


Police located the crash and had the road closed for a period of time.
The driver left the scene on foot, but was quickly arrested. A passenger of the truck the man was operating suffered non life treatening injuries, but had to be transported to the hospital for treatment.


A 62 year old Dartmouth man was charged with, and held for court:


-Impaired operation of a conveyance causing bodily harm.

-Having a blood alcohol content of 80 mgs% or more.

-Failing to remain at the scene of an accident.
